    Digital Cable Advisor Missing From Windows 7

    Hello friends,

    I recently bought the computer system, And I have installed windows 7 operating system over it. But the thing is that 'Digital Cable Advisor' is missing from the 'Windows Media Center'. Previously I had windows vista operating system, then I upgraded it with windows 7 OS. I am not getting the cause behind this missing of 'Digital Cable Advisor', and procedure to recover it. I wonder if you are able to help me over this issue. I am waiting for your reply.

    Re: Digital Cable Advisor Missing From Windows 7

    Please try following solution to sort out Digital Cable Advisor issue:
    • First you need to Open Programs and Features from the Control Panel.
    • The next steps is to select "Turn Windows features on or off".
    • After this you need to uncheck "Windows Media Center" by expanding the "Media Features" and try to restart it
    • Then you will need to again open 'Turn Windows features on or off' feature, then restart the 'Windows Media Center'.
